I mean no offense, but it will not slow or prevent it. Remember, meth is only on when we are in boost potentially "washing" the intake runners/valves/head but this is all dependent on volume and location of the jets. Direct port 500+cc/min jets will dump meth/fuel volume which could wet the carbon build up (to dissolve, erode or wash the top layer away) but guaranteed a lot of people are running smaller cc/min and throttle body or further back so by the time it reaches the head it's minimal fluid volume and atomizes. Carbon build up occurs in vacuum when you are not spraying meth. I've run direct port jets for years, carbon build up was still there.

meth does nothing to prevent carbon. I just cleaned my valves and replaced my intake, and after probably 50k miles with a dual nozzle setup, the carbon was probably 1/8" thick in some places. It was nasty.

I ran water methanol system on my car for 3 years and at 75K mi took car in for carbon cleaning and folks that saw the pics said it looked just like a car without water meth, no reduction in carbon build up. Water meth was installed at about 40K miles.

I will say that most of us don't install direct port or TB nozzle systems when the cars are new. Usually the cars have been modded over time and we eventually put w/m on as we reach that level. So its harder to say would it prevent or slow down carbon build up rather than will it clean a motor with mileage on it.
